			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Welcome to Social Media Week! As we kick off, want to know what&#8217;s happening online with SMW12? Love data? Whether it&#8217;s your first time participating with SMW12 or your third, you&#8217;ve never seen realtime action like this. Social Media Week is proud to present SMW RealTime, powered by Nokia and presented by The Guardian. A 5-page data aggregation dashboard pulling all the real-time data from Social Media Week globally and locally.</p>
<p>And here are the top 5 things you need to know about it.</p>
<p>1. <strong>It looks pretty</strong>, if we may say so. Instead of just pushing out data, RealTime largely uses infographics to visualize all the data coming out of SMW12. With graphs and images, and a pretty user-friendly layout, it makes exploring events, cities and SMW12 easy on the eyes.<br />
&nbsp;</p>
<p>2. <strong>It&#8217;s multilayered</strong>. Data can be broken down on a global, city and event level. If it&#8217;s an official hashtag, it&#8217;s being tracked. So, use those city hashtags and handles and tweet away!<br />
&nbsp;</p>
<p><a href="http://ig.socialmediaweek.org/index.php" target="_blank"><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-12898" title="Screen shot 2012-02-12 at 9.28.59 PM" src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2012/02/Screen-shot-2012-02-12-at-9.28.59-PM.png" alt="" width="307" height="243" /></a>3. <strong>It&#8217;s interactive</strong>. Each day of SMW12, we&#8217;ll ask you a different question. How do you use social and digital? How does that play out in your life? Some are fun; others more serious. The results will then be highlighted and tracked right in RealTime.<br />
&nbsp;</p>
<p>4. <strong>It&#8217;s trending</strong>. <em>Ok, it&#8217;s not really.</em> But we&#8217;re looking at what&#8217;s trending and will feature trending topics from SMW12 on each of the 3 levels: event, city, and global. RealTime breaks down the number of tweets per hashtag and topic and lets you know the most popular Twitter handles, keeping you in the know. You can even follow the most popular tweeters straight from the dashboard!<br />
&nbsp;</p>
<p>5. <strong>It&#8217;s tracking it all.</strong> Number of events on a daily and weekly basis? Check. <em>(Today we&#8217;re at 192 events.)</em> Number of attendees? <em>(That&#8217;s 89,450 registrations.)</em> Speakers and number of venues? <em>(Got that, too: 2137 speakers, 483 venues.)</em> RealTime also tracks Foursquare check-ins, so make sure you check-ins! But make sure you&#8217;re watching the dashboard. Because it&#8217;s in real-time, you can&#8217;t go back!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Maybe you have seen one, a Facebook post from one of your 500 friends saying how down they feel and how they are thinking about hurting themselves. When you see this post not only are you witnessing someone else is crisis, but it puts you in a crisis of your own. What should you do? What if this is a hoax &#8211; but what if it isn’t?</p>
<p>Facebook has recognized this issue and its severity, and has taken steps to make their site safer. Last week the National Suicide Prevention Lifeline partnered with Facebook to provide a chat service for those who are in suicidal crisis. So now when someone says they are going to kill themselves on Facebook and someone reports it (by using the <a href="http://www.facebook.com/help/contact.php?show_form=suicidal_content">existing reporting system</a>) Facebook then reaches out to offer a chat service. I want to underscore here that  for this system to work, Facebook users need to report the suicidal content. You and I are the first responders. I can&#8217;t think of a better use for the internet.</p>
<p>The Lifeline has received over 3 million calls to 1-800-273-TALK (8255) since its launch in 2005. However people who like to express themselves online may not want to pick up the phone, so a chat service is a better match for them. “Our Facebook community requested this service, they have reached out to us to say, I need help but I don’t want to call. Do you have text? Do you have chat?” says Lidia Bernik, Associate Project Director at Lifeline. “We have listened to our community and with the help of Facebook we are getting them the help they need and have asked for.”</p>
<p>This is great advancement for suicide prevention as Lifeline adds to its hotline services. One of the most exciting facets to this new technology is the data it affords the suicide prevention community. A conversion rate, from when help is offered to help received, will now be available. This is very valuable information that has eluded the hotline.</p>
<p>The chat service is much needed as more and more people go Facebook to make their cry for help.  Tyler Clementi, the Rutgers student who died by suicide last year, posted this on Facebook right before his death: “Jumping off the GW bridge sorry.” What if someone reported that? What if Tyler began chatting online with a suicide crisis counselor?</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This past Social Media Week, we unveiled our <a href="http://socialmediaweek.org/blog/2011/09/13/top-10-social-media-events-of-2011/" target="_blank">Top 10 Social Media Events of 2011</a>. And as the year closes, several new events have got our attention- events that fell in line with our listing of events that were defined and fundamentally shaped by the use of media. </p>
<p>Due to this, Social Media Week has reviewed our top 10 events and compiled our Year in Review of Top Social Media Events of 2011. </p>
<p><a href="http://socialmediaweek.org/blog/2011/12/09/year-in-review-top-social-media-events-of-2011/5480361553_dc79c78e48_m/" rel="attachment wp-att-10755"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/5480361553_dc79c78e48_m.jpg" alt="" title="5480361553_dc79c78e48_m" width="240" height="160"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-10755" /></a><strong>1. Arab Spring and the Middle Eastern uprisings</strong><br />
While the original uprising in the Arab Spring began in 2010, the latter part of 2011 saw great changes in these areas, from the stepping down of Mubarak and further unrest between the Egyptian military and civilians to Libyan dictator Qaddafi&#8217;s death to Yemen seeing Selah step down this November. Behind it all, was social media helping organize protesters and revolutionaries, enable citizen journalism, and garner public support.<br />
<em>Photo by Collin David Anderson</em><br />
<br/><br />
<a href="http://www.flickr.com/photos/kordian/5565092187/"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/5565092187_e9654dfd3e_m.jpg" alt="" title="5565092187_e9654dfd3e_m" width="240" height="172"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-10766" /></a><strong>2. Japanese earthquake and tsunami</strong><br />
As one of the world&#8217;s worst earthquakes and tsunami&#8217;s ravaged a nation, the  rest of the world watched as this terrible disaster played out in real-time, with tweets and videos being posted within minutes. Fortunately, the world did not just sit by and watch but also mobilized to provide assistance- from Crisis Commons to Google&#8217;s People Finder to online donations pouring in. <em>Photo by Kordian</em><br />
<br/><br />
<br/><br />
<a href="http://images.google.com/imgres?q=occupy+wall+street&amp;start=21&amp;num=10&amp;hl=en&amp;biw=1680&amp;bih=762&amp;tbs=sur:fm&amp;tbm=isch&amp;tbnid=h0NRwwM3KRD9pM:&amp;imgrefurl=http://lucaskrech.com/blog/index.php/2011/11/&amp;docid=uqeLkG09UZ0MlM&amp;imgurl=http://lucaskrech.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/APTOPIX_Occupy_Seattle_0aa4c.jpg&amp;w=606&amp;h=404&amp;ei=6BviTsXHNqPu0gH4w_T0BQ&amp;zoom=1&amp;iact=hc&amp;vpx=889&amp;vpy=211&amp;dur=1214&amp;hovh=183&amp;hovw=275&amp;tx=151&amp;ty=112&amp;sig=105546447954032318199&amp;sqi=2&amp;page=2&amp;tbnh=154&amp;tbnw=205&amp;ndsp=21&amp;ved=1t:429,r:4,s:21"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/APTOPIX_Occupy_Seattle_0aa4c-300x200.jpg" alt="" title="APTOPIX_Occupy_Seattle_0aa4c" width="240" height="172"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-10771" /></a><strong>3. Occupy Wall Street</strong><br />
Inspired by success in other countries, a small group of protesters gathered in NYC&#8217;s Zuccotti Park in October- creating the US&#8217;s first major protest scene since the 70&#8242;s. Spanning over 1000 cities around the world, thousands have banded together to speak out against economic inequality and other mounting injustices. Technology and social media have been instrumental in organizing the protests, disseminating the movement&#8217;s global message, and documenting police responses, often culminating in several hundred thousands of views on their UStream and Livestreamed events. <em>Photo by Light Cue 23</em></p>
<p><br/><br />
<a href="http://www.flickr.com/photos/pittpanthersfan/6216184196/"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/6216184196_d925b7b85d_m.jpg" alt="" title="6216184196_d925b7b85d_m" width="240" height="160"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-10778" /></a><strong>4. Death of Steve Jobs</strong><br />
The death of Steve Jobs, the epitome of tech innovation, created a wake in the tech and cultural world unrivaled since the death of Michael Jackson. Tweets, impromptu memorials, Facebook posts, montage videos- all flooded the web for the weeks following. And we could not soon forget this icon, with his autobiography being released just two weeks after his death.<br />
<em>Photo by Kyle Wagaman</em></p>
<p><br/><br />
<a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=kfVsfOSbJY0"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/Screen-shot-2011-12-09-at-9.42.55-AM-300x169.png" alt="" title="Screen shot 2011-12-09 at 9.42.55 AM" width="240" height="152"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-10783" /></a><strong>5. Rebecca Black’s Friday and subsequent backlash</strong><br />
No other meme shined brighter- and longer- than Rebecca Black&#8217;s Friday. And the public mocking and backlash raised important questions about digital abuse and how our cultures treat fame. While we still debate how society should respond, the music industry is learning that traditional business models aren&#8217;t as effective without utilizing the vast advances in technology.<br />
<br/><br />
<br/></p>
<p><strong>6. High-Speed Access Being Seen as a Right</strong><br />
Many nations are now making vast improvements to access to high-speed, broadband wireless access. With the EU demanding that all nations allocate 800MHz band available for wireless and US President Obama making access a priority, technology is now longer just a way to achieve equality- it is becoming a right in and of itself. </p>
<p><br/><br />
<a href="http://www.yourbdnews.com/2011/08/10/london-riots-and-unrest-hits-manchester/london-riot"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/london-riot-300x189.jpg" alt="" title="london-riot" width="240" height="160"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-10791" /></a><strong>7. UK Riots</strong><br />
While not as long-standing as the revolutions- nor as politically effective- three long nights of rioting in London were being blamed on text and instant messaging on mobile devices. British police broke into smart phones to thwart planned attacks on local establishments, and even considered blocking access to social networking sites altogether. Followed shortly by US city San Francisco&#8217;s transit&#8217;s banning of cell service, many citizens around the globe began to wonder if their governments might also start restricting or investigating access further. </p>
<p><br/><br />
<strong>8. Hurricane Irene</strong><br />
While nowhere nearly as devastating as the Japanese disaster, Hurricane Irene was an online storm in it&#8217;s own right. Storm chasers didn’t need to leave their home to follow the path of Hurricane Irene, as it made its way up the East Coast in August, conjuring tweets on par with the traffic after the Japan earthquake.</p>
<p><br/><br />
<a href="http://www.flickr.com/photos/19354469@N00/5481826395/"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/5481826395_cf62aa37d5_m.jpg" alt="" title="5481826395_cf62aa37d5_m" width="240" height="160"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-10796" /></a><strong>9. Anthony Weiner Twitter scandal</strong><br />
Few can forget US politician Anthony Weiner&#8217;s plight, the world’s first true 21st century political scandal. Born through the use of and then broken, spread and developed by social media, Weiner&#8217;s misuse of DM&#8217;s caused his political demise and highlighted on the way social media tools are impacting the way politicians communicate with their constituents and the broader public for years to come. <em>Photo by Marc Faletti</em></p>
<p><br/><br />
<a href="http://socialmediaweek.org/blog/2011/12/09/year-in-review-top-social-media-events-of-2011/linkedin_logo_11-2/" rel="attachment wp-att-10803"><img src="http://socialmediaweek.org/files/2011/12/linkedin_logo_111-300x89.jpg" alt="" title="linkedin_logo_11" width="200" height="59"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-10803" /></a><strong>10. Social Media IPO’s</strong><br />
We&#8217;ve seen vast changes in the funding of social media companies. With successful startups like Pandora, Facebook, and LinkedIn going public and a growing list of other companies that will follow suit. And we can&#8217;t forget start-ups like Diaspora and other Kickstarter grantees- forcing us to re-evaluate how companies can be funded and who the main investors just might be. </p>
